    Oh the fun hasn't even started for you :D Looks like it's about time to invest in a CUC. Also, do you have any powerheads? If there's one thing that's good about GHA (other than getting rid of your nitrates formed during your cycle) is that it really helps aim powerheads. Especially on the rocks. You can aim them to cover whatever area you want just by looking at how the GHA waves in the flow :)
